An Act Establishing A Task Force To Study And Develop A Policy To Reduce The Number Of Auto Thefts And Break-ins And Other Personal Property Crimes.
Impact
The establishment of this task force would create a structured framework for evaluating existing laws and policies related to auto theft and property crimes. It is anticipated that the task force will conduct a thorough review of best practices both within the state and in other jurisdictions. The recommendations generated from this task force could lead to revisions of current legislation, enhancing the effectiveness of law enforcement strategies and potentially leading to a decrease in these crimes. This proactive approach aims not only to mitigate crime rates but also to foster stronger community relations with law enforcement.
Summary
House Bill 05357 aims to establish a legislative task force specifically designed to study and develop new policy recommendations aimed at reducing the incidence of auto thefts, break-ins, and other personal property crimes. This bill is introduced to address growing concerns about the prevalence of such crimes, which have significant impacts on community safety and public trust. By forming a dedicated group of stakeholders, the bill seeks to bring together law enforcement, community representatives, and policy experts to analyze current approaches and identify effective measures for prevention and enforcement.
Contention
While the bill is largely seen as a positive step towards addressing public safety concerns, there may be contention around the allocation of state resources and the effectiveness of task forces in producing tangible results. Critics might express skepticism about whether a task force can lead to effective policy changes or if additional funding would be more beneficial in expanding existing law enforcement capabilities. Additionally, some could argue that the focus should shift to preventative measures rather than solely on reviewing policies post-crime, raising questions about the best allocation of legislative effort and resources.
